Your violets need bright light in order to thrive and bloom, but not direct sun. So as long as they are in a room that gets bright, indirect sunlight, they should do just fine. In fact, direct sun can burn their leaves. If they aren't getting any bright light at all, there are grow lights you can buy that will help.
